November 30- December 24
|
Advent Candle Lighting Service
|
-
Each Sunday during Advent, candles will be lighted in the service as the congregation prepares for the coming of Christmas. Pastor Ed Townsend has prepared a short service including a Scripture reading, meditation and a prayer. There is also a candle lighting song.
Week one: Mary and the fulfillment of God's promises.
Week two: Joseph and the great gift of love.
Week three: Shepherds and the Good News of Christmas
Week four: Foreigners and a discovery
Join us at church as we prepare for Christmas. Prepare at home with members of your household.

Pastoral leadership
|
-
The Council presented the recommendation of the Search committee to a special congregational meeting, that the church call the Rev. Edward D. Townsend as pastor. The proposal was adopted by a unanimous vote and greeted with aplause.
Mr. Townsend will also continue as the pastor of Three Steeples United Church, which worships at Paris.
The members of the search committee were Diane Brady, Janet Dangler, Mary Dickinson, Edie Eastman, Joyce Lloyd and Dot McConnell. The congregation enthusiastically expressed its gratitude to the committee for work carefully and quickly done.
